The Heart-in-Mouth audio poetry competition, curated by Dave Lordan and Colm Keegan and supported by Fingal county libraries.

Budding writers and performers in the locality are invited to record their most heartfelt work and send it as an MP3 file to Lordan and Keegan, who will judge entries on the strength of the reading as well as the content of the work. The winner will receive an iPod and, along with two runners-up, an invitation to take part in a poetry showcase. The competition closing date is April 20th. Dublin City Book Fair, which will take place tomorrow at the Tara Towers Hotel, Merrion Road, Dublin 4, from 11am to 5pm, with 20 booksellers from around Ireland. The range of books on offer is wide, from finer rare items to everyday reading. Admission is €2; accompanied children are free, as is parking. For details, email schullbooks@eircom.net.
